I always machine bind my quilts. I have gotten quite good at it. I cut my strips 3.5 inches. I like a little wider binding. Sew at the binding to the front at half an inch turn to the back and stitch in the ditch from the front. I like the fact that the binding is stitched down so it won't come loose. If you use a matching thread color you don't see it on the back. But there are no rules in quilting, you do what you feel comfortable doing.
